LT1632IN8#PBF belongs to the category of integrated circuits (ICs).
This product is commonly used in electronic devices for signal conditioning and amplification purposes.
The LT1632IN8#PBF comes in an 8-pin PDIP (Plastic Dual In-Line Package) package.
This IC is essential for amplifying and conditioning signals in various electronic systems.

The LT1632IN8#PBF operates based on the principles of operational amplifiers. It amplifies the input signal while maintaining high gain, low distortion, and accurate output representation. The IC's internal circuitry ensures stability, precision, and reliability in various operating conditions.

Q: What is the LT1632IN8#PBF? A: The LT1632IN8#PBF is a precision, low-power operational amplifier (op-amp) manufactured by Linear Technology.
Q: What are the key features of the LT1632IN8#PBF? A: Some key features include low input offset voltage, low input bias current, rail-to-rail inputs and outputs, and low power consumption.
Q: What is the typical supply voltage range for the LT1632IN8#PBF? A: The typical supply voltage range is from ±2.5V to ±15V.
Q: Can the LT1632IN8#PBF operate with a single supply voltage? A: Yes, it can operate with a single supply voltage as low as 2.7V.
Q: What is the maximum output current capability of the LT1632IN8#PBF? A: The maximum output current capability is typically around 20mA.
Q: Is the LT1632IN8#PBF suitable for low-noise applications? A: Yes, it has low input noise voltage and current, making it suitable for low-noise applications.
Q: Can the LT1632IN8#PBF drive capacitive loads? A: Yes, it has a high slew rate and can drive capacitive loads up to 100pF without significant degradation in performance.
Q: What is the temperature range in which the LT1632IN8#PBF operates? A: The LT1632IN8#PBF operates over a temperature range of -40°C to 85°C.
Q: Can the LT1632IN8#PBF be used in battery-powered applications? A: Yes, it has low power consumption and can be used in battery-powered applications.
